 Type 1 diabetes, also known as juvenile diabetes or insulin-dependent diabetes, is an autoimmune disease where the body's immune system attacks and destroys the insulin-producing beta cells in the pancreas. Without insulin, glucose cannot enter the body's cells to be used for energy, causing a dangerous buildup of sugar in the bloodstream. Type 1 diabetes accounts for about 5-10% of all diagnosed cases of diabetes and usually appears in childhood or early adulthood, but can develop at any age. Causes and Risk Factors The exact causes of this diabetes are still unclear, but researchers believe that genetics play a major role. Those with a family history of type 1 diabetes or other autoimmune diseases have a higher likelihood of developing the condition. Viruses and other environmental factors may also trigger the autoimmune response that destroys pancreatic beta cells in genetically susceptible individuals. Rheology modifiers are multifunctional additives used to alter the flow properties and improve the performance of thickened fluids. These thickening agents are used to modify the rheological behavior or viscosity of solutions and suspensions. The viscosity and shear properties of fluids can be increased, decreased or kept stable by using appropriate modifiers. Some of the key types of rheology modifiers used across different industries include: - Thickeners: Used to increase the viscosity and thickness of fluids without significantly impacting other properties. Common thickeners include cellulosic polymers, synthetic polymers, fumed silica etc. - Thinners/Fluid Reducers: Added to reduce the viscosity and thickness of thickened fluids. Examples include water, glycols, alcohols etc. - Anti-settling Agents: Maintain suspensions by preventing particles from settling out of solutions under gravity or shear. What is DKD? Diabetic kidney disease, also called diabetic nephropathy, is a condition in which the kidneys are damaged due to diabetes. Over time, high blood sugar levels from diabetes can damage the tiny blood vessels in the kidneys, called the glomeruli. This interferes with the kidneys' ability to filter waste from the blood and can lead to serious medical problems. DKD is a leading cause of end-stage Diabetic Kidney Disease (ESKD). ESKD is when the kidneys have lost most of their function. At this stage, a person often needs regular dialysis or a kidney transplant to survive. Unfortunately, many people with diabetes are unaware they have kidney disease until it has reached an advanced stage. That's why it's so important for people with diabetes to have their kidney function monitored regularly. The Burden of Typhoid Fever: A Global Perspective Typhoid Fever , caused by the bacterium Salmonella Typhi, remains a substantial public health challenge worldwide. The disease primarily spreads through contaminated food and water, disproportionately affecting communities with inadequate sanitation and hygiene practices. With an estimated 10-20 million cases and over 100,000 fatalities annually, the urgency to address this preventable illness cannot be overstated.
